Rapid carbothermic synthesis of silicon carbide nano ...
2012-7-1 The overall reaction of formation for SiC through carbothermic reduction is normally written as: (1)SiO2(s) + 3C (s) = SiC (s) + 2CO (g) This reaction is strongly endothermic with Δ H ° 298 = 618.5 kJ mol −1 and the SiC formation begins at a temperature of about 1500 °C. Addition of calcium compounds to the carbothermic ...
Silicon is typically produced via the carbothermic reduction of silicon dioxide (SiO 2) with a solid carbonaceous reducing agent. The silicon dioxide may be in the form of quartz, fused or fume silica, or the like. The carbonaceous material may be in the form of coke. coal, woodchips. and other forms of carboncontaining materials.
